In March, Palouse, United States, experiences a significant juxtaposition in weather, with maximum temperatures reaching 19°C (66°F) while the average hovers around a brisk 4°C (40°F). Visitors should be prepared for chilly nights, as minimum temperatures can drop to -15°C (6°F). The month witnesses 79 mm (3.1 in) of precipitation spread over 14 days, yielding a damp atmosphere characterized by humidity levels of 87%. March in the Palouse sees a relatively moderate precipitation level of 79 mm (3.1 in), slightly lower than the preceding months of January and February. With rainfall spread across 14 days, the weather begins to shift as spring approaches, but it remains wetter than the drier months ahead. This pattern continues into April, with precipitation amounts gradually decreasing, signaling a transition toward the drier late spring and summer months. Interestingly, March's precipitation aligns closely with January's, indicating a consistent winter wetness before the seasonal shift, while contrasting sharply with the minimal rainfall of July, when only 5 mm (0.2 in) is recorded. In March, the Palouse region experiences a slight dip in humidity, measuring at 87%, which is a modest decrease from the steady 89% observed in both January and February. This trend of gradually lowering humidity levels continues into April as it falls to 84%, signaling the onset of spring. As the temperatures warm and daylight increases, humidity levels will further decrease throughout the coming months, hitting their lowest point of 64% in August. March in Palouse marks a notable shift in UV exposure as the UV Index rises to 5, categorized as moderate. This increase from February’s 4 indicates that spring is on the horizon, as residents can expect to spend about 30 minutes in the sun before risking a burn. This trend showcases a gradual ramp-up in UV radiation, paving the way for even higher levels in the approaching months. With April and May bringing much sharper increases—peaking at 8 and 9 respectively—March serves as a perfect reminder to start prioritizing sun safety as outdoor activities become more frequent. As winter gives way to spring, March in the Palouse sees a notable increase in daylight duration. With approximately 11 hours of daylight, March marks a significant transition from the 8 hours experienced in January and the 10 hours in February. This gradual increase is part of a broader trend where daylight extends steadily into the coming months. As nature awakens, residents can look forward to even longer days ahead in April and May, with daylight peaking at 15 hours during the summer months. March in the Palouse showcases a familiar rhythm of wind, with an average speed of 3.3 m/s (7 mph)—the same as January. This consistency hints at a gradual transition into spring, as the breezes remain relatively gentle compared to the brisker conditions of late winter and early autumn. Following March, April experiences a slight uptick with an average of 3.5 m/s (8 mph), signaling an increase in wind activity that often accompanies the blooming landscape. Notably, the wind speeds dip during the summer months, reaching a low of 2.6 m/s (6 mph) in July, providing a soothing calmness over the region. As the seasons shift toward fall, winds once again pick up, peaking in November at 3.8 m/s (8 mph).
